Right now, Mohamed Salah is one of the top five players in the world. Arriving at Anfield to a somewhat skeptical fan base after his poor stint with Chelsea, Salah quickly silenced any critics he may have had, proving to be one of the bargains of the year at just £36 million. The number of records he has broken and awards he has received is somewhat ridiculous.

The 32 goals he netted in the Premier League last season is the most by anyone in a 38 game season, the three separate Player of the Month awards he took home is also a new record, in addition to winning the PFA Player of the Year, Liverpool Player of the Year, and Liverpool Players' Player of the Year. If Sergio Ramos hadn't channeled his inner Brock Lesnar in Kiev he may well have led The Reds to European glory for the first time in 13 years on top of this.

The Egyptian, who scored his first World Cup goals this summer, is a genuine contender for the Ballon d'Or in the next few years, and we shouldn't be surprised if he is living in Madrid when this happens.
